    The former school in Bothoa, a small town in the Côtes d’Armor, recreates the studious and nostalgic atmosphere of a rural classroom in the 1930’s - waxed wooden desks, the smell of chalk and ink. Wander down memory lane, to a time when lessons were held in dictation, morals, maths and writing in pen and ink. In a classroom there's an exhibition dedicated to the Bothoa school – class photos, a film produced in the school in 1962, certificates… In the playground is the teacher’s house, which has been fitted out to show what it was like for the first teacher, who lived there from 1931 to 1947. The objects and furniture will take you back 80 years in time.
